•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Raporlamada hata

Katılım
31 Ağustos 2005
Mesajlar
1,534
Excel Vers. ve Dili
Excel 2003 - Türkçe
Merhaba;

Ekteki çalışmada, formdan seçilen kişiye ait hesap hareketleri var ise raporlama normal olarak yapılıyor.

Fakat formdan seçtiğimiz kişinin aynı formdaki altformda hesap hareketleri yok ise, raporlamada adı ve bilgileri gözükmediği gibi, alt toplamlarda da hata işareti vermektedir.

Bunun düzeltilmesi için ne yapılabilir?.

Teşekkürler.
 
Eğer bu kişiye ait bir hareket yoksa raporun "Bu kişiye ait bir bilgi yoktur" uyarısı verip açılmaması işinizi görür mü? Örneği inceleyin..
 
Sayın mehmetdemiral Hocam,

Şu makroların m sinden anlamıyorum.

Kısaca bir bahseder misin burada hazırladığınız makro ne zaman devreye giriyor?

Anlamadım. Şimdi literatür karıştırmayı da gözüm kesmedi açıkçası. Hazırcı olalım herzamanki gibi.

Ama lütfedip cevap da yazsanız ancak yarın sabah okuyabilecem. Malum sahur filan. Erken yatmak lazım.

Bu vesile ile de herkesin Ramazan-ı Şerif-i mübarek olsun diyelim.
 
Sayın Mehmetdemiral;

Çok teşekkür ediyorum.
Sizlerin sayesinde access denizinde boğulmamaya çalışıyoruz.

Selam ve saygılarımla.
 
Makrolar aslında bazı eylemlerin toplu olarak tek bir hamlede yapılmasını sağlıyorlar. Bu arada accessdeki makrolar kalıp olarak gelen bazı eylemleri yapmak için kullanılıyorlar, biz makro eylemi yazmıyoruz. Mesela kod ile bir formu açmak için acceswste sihirbaz yardımıyla DoCmd.OpenForm ile başlayan bir kod oluştururken bunu makro ekranında formaç adlı makroyla yapıp paşa paşa aşağıda istenenleri doldurarak aynı işlemi yapıyoruz. Yani bu makro işini çok kafaya takmayın, aslında dünyanın en kolay iş yaptırma yoludur. Kod falan yazmaya erinen benim gibi tembeller bazen bir makro tasarlayıp içinde bir sürü ekleme sorgusu, form açma-kapatma işlemi yaptırılar. Mesela benim bir güncelleme makrom var, her programımda kullanırım. Çoğu zaman kod yazarak yaptığımız önceki kayda git- sonraki kayda git ya da formu kapat yeniden aç gibi girilen verilerin ekrana gelmesi gerektiğinde ve requery komutunun işe yaramadığı durumlarda kullanırım. Bunun için bir makro tasarlarsınız ve içine önce 1. eylem olarak kaydagit eylemini, aşağıdan da değer olarak öncekikayıtı seçersiniz. Sonra da 2. satıra kaydagit koyup bu kez de sonrakkayıtı seçersiniz. Bu makroyu da mesela bir metin kutusunun değiştiğinde olay yordamına koyarsınız olur biter. Eğer bu işlemi birçok kez yapmanız gerekiyorsa herzaman bu makroyu çağırırsınız olur biter. Bilmem anlatabildim mi?
 
Evet, teşekkürler.

(Biz de bunadık herhalde, soru sormuşuz, lütfedip cevap vermiş, teşekkür etmemişiz)
 
Geri
Üst